Edit in WordPressDebian is a powerful, stable, and versatile open-source operating system used by millions of servers and desktops worldwide. Known for its reliability, security features, and large repository of free software packages, Debian serves as the foundation for many popular Linux distributions.
Debian is the core foundation for many popular Linux distributions, with Ubuntu being the most widespread derivative. Ubuntu builds on Debian’s stability but focuses on ease of use, frequent updates, and broader hardware support, making it ideal for beginners and enterprises.
